A motor is supplied by a PWM signal so that speed is proportional to the average value of the PWM signal. I need to measure the profile of the average value of the signal. Is a typical analogue input channel can do this or need pre-conditioning circuit.

Thank you for any help.
 
what is frequency of the PWM?
what is sampling speed of your analog card?
what is range of current you want to measure?
what is voltage of the motor circuit?
what is type (and range) of the analog input you plan on using?
do you need isolation?
 
About 1 kHz, peak volt 140 V (I can divide it down). Motor current about 2 A. Need isolation. No idea on analogue card yet. Just to find any card can perform such measurement without need of signal pre-conditioning (low pass filter etc) first.
 
I personally don't know of any plc analog input that will allow you to use this without filtering. If you know your PWM period you may be able to use a counter card to measure your pulse width. In a DC system the pulse width should be roughly proportional to speed. This is very PLC dependent though. The easiest and cheapest method will most likely be using a passive first order low pass filter and an isolator module prior to a PLC input.

If this is just for fun or personaly use you may be able to build up a circuit using a clock source, an opto-isolator, a gate, a counter and a D/A converter to get an analog value equal to the pulse width. But I wouldn't use this in an industrial environment.
